Transfer speed
USB supports three data rates.
A Low Speed rate of *.5 Mbit/s (*8* KiB/s) that is mostly used for Human Interface Devices (HID) such as key***rds, mice, and joysticks.
A Full Speed rate of *2 Mbit/s (*.5 MiB/s). Full Speed was the fastest rate before the USB 2.0 specification and many devices fall back to Full Speed. Full Speed devices divide the USB bandwidth between them in a first-come first-served basis and it is not uncommon to run out of bandwidth with several isochronous devices. All USB Hubs support Full Speed.
A Hi-Speed rate of 480 Mbit/s (57 MiB/s).
